Webacr_values=urn:se:curity:authentication:html-form:html1. max_age. Specifies a maximum allowed age for the SSO session (in seconds) If the session is older, the user is prompted to login again. max_age=300. prompt. Navigate to … hiking sugarloaf mountainWeb12 de mai. de 2016 · 3. ADFS is a very different beast to Azure AD. ADFS 2.0 has no OAuth support. ADFS 3.0 has some OAuth support (No OpenID Connect, Web API only) and you have to use PowerShell. Refer: Securing a Web API with ADFS on WS2012 R2 Got Even Easier for an example.
